Background technology
LED full name are that semiconductor light-emitting-diode is directly to convert electrical energy into made of semi-conducting material Luminous energy, electric signal are converted into the luminescent device of optical signal, its main feature is that low in energy consumption, high brightness, beautiful in colour, anti-vibration, service life It is long(Normal luminous 8-10 ten thousand hours), cold light source the advantages that, be real " green illumination ", using LED as the lamp decoration product of light source In the future of 21 century, necessarily replace incandescent lamp, becomes the revolution again of mankind's illumination.
LED lamp bead generally can all generate higher heat during converting electrical energy into luminous energy, and high temperature can direct shadow The service life of LED lamp bead is rung, people are more permanent in order to make the service life of LED lamp bead, can all pacify in the bottom of LED lamp bead Heat sink is filled to radiate to it, heat sink is typically all the bottom for being directly anchored to LED lamp bead, cannot directly be torn open It unloading, when people need replacing or repair LED lamp bead, it is also necessary to people are dismantled heat sink using multiple types of tools, by Time and the muscle power of people can be wasted in manually dismounting, to be brought not to people when repairing or replacing LED lamp bead Just.

As shown in Figs. 1-2, the utility model provides a kind of technical solution:A kind of LED lamp bead of heat sink easy to disassemble, packet Fixed plate 1 is included, the upper surface of fixed plate 1 is connected with positive electrode 2 and negative electrode 3, and positive electrode 2 is located at fixation with negative electrode 3 The left and right sides of 1 trade mark of plate, and LED luminescence chips 4 are provided between positive electrode 2 and negative electrode 3, and the upper surface of fixed plate 1 Lens 5 are fixedly connected with, and positive electrode 2, negative electrode 3 and LED luminescence chips 4 are respectively positioned on the inside of lens 5.
The lower surface of fixed plate 1 is overlapped with the upper surface of heat-conducting plate 6, the upper surface of the lower surface and heat sink 7 of heat-conducting plate 6 Overlap joint, the length of heat-conducting plate 6 is more than the length of fixed plate 1, and the length of heat sink 7 is more than the length of heat-conducting plate 6, and positive electrode 2 bottom end sequentially passes through the first through hole 8 that 6 upper surface of heat-conducting plate opens up and the second through-hole 9 that 7 upper surface of heat sink opens up and prolongs The lower section of heat sink 7 is extended to, the shape of first through hole 8 is round, and the shape phase of the shape of the second through-hole 9 and first through hole 8 Deng by the way that the shape of first through hole 8 and the second through-hole 9 is arranged, positive electrode 2 capable of being made smoothly logical from first through hole 8 and second Extraction in hole 9, and the bottom end of negative electrode 3 sequentially passes through 7 upper surface of third through-hole 10 and heat sink that 6 upper surface of heat-conducting plate opens up The fourth hole 11 that opens up and the lower section for extending to heat sink 7, the shape of third through-hole 10 are circle, and the shape of fourth hole 11 The shape of shape and third through-hole 10 is equal, by the way that the shape of third through-hole 10 and fourth hole 11 is arranged, negative electrode 3 can be made suitable Extraction in the slave third through-hole 10 and fourth hole 11 of profit.
The left and right sides of lens 5 have been fixedly connected with the first fixed block 12, and the right side of the first fixed block 12 offers The inside of card slot 13, card slot 13 is connected with fixture block 14, and by the way that fixture block 14 and card slot 13 is arranged, people rotate the second fixed block 15 and enclose It is rotated around axis pin 20, makes the extraction out of card slot 13 of fixture block 14, then heat-conducting plate 6 and heat sink 7 is pushed to move down, make positive electrode 2 and the extraction out of first through hole 8, the second through-hole 9, third through-hole 10 and fourth hole 11 respectively of negative electrode 3, to just can be direct Heat sink 7 is dismantled, the right side of fixture block 14 is fixedly connected on the left side of the second fixed block 15, the second fixed block 15 Lower surface is fixedly connected with the first connecting plate 16, and the lower surface of the first connecting plate 16 is fixedly connected with elastic device 17, elasticity dress It includes telescopic rod 171 to set 17, and the surface of telescopic rod 171 is socketed with spring 172, and the top of telescopic rod 171 and spring 172 is fixed It is connected to the lower surface of the first connecting plate 16, and the bottom end of telescopic rod 171 and spring 172 is fixedly connected in the second connecting plate 18 Upper surface, pass through be arranged elastic device 17, after fixture block 14 sticks into 13 inside of card slot, 172 energy of spring in elastic device 17 Enough fixture block 14 is pulled to move down using itself pulling force, to even closer, the elastic device for making fixture block 14 be clamped with card slot 13 17 bottom end is fixedly connected with the second connecting plate 18, and the lower surface of the second connecting plate 18 is fixedly connected with the first link block 19, the The back side of one link block 19 is hinged by the front of axis pin 20 and the second link block 21, by the way that axis pin 20 is arranged, can make fixture block 14 will not detach after rotation with heat sink 7, to be brought convenience to people when reinstalling heat sink 7, the second link block 21 left side is fixedly connected with the right side of heat sink 7.
In use, the heat that the work of LED luminescence chips 4 generates can be transferred directly to heat sink 7 by heat-conducting plate 6, radiate Plate 7 can scatter and disappear the heat that LED luminescence chips 4 generate, when people need to dismantle heat sink 7, people first The second fixed block 15 is rotated forward around axis pin 20, the second fixed block 15 drives fixture block 14 to rotate, when the rotation of fixture block 14 is from card slot In 13 after extraction, people push heat-conducting plate 6 and heat sink 7 to move down again, keep positive electrode 2 and negative electrode 3 logical from first respectively Extraction, then just can directly dismantle heat sink 7 in hole 8, the second through-hole 9, third through-hole 10 and fourth hole 11.
